download directory button not working in frontend mode

Bug #226345 reported by mrhappi
2
Affects Status Importance Assigned to Milestone
LottaNZB
Fix Released
High
Severin H

Bug Description

File browser does not appear when the Download Directory button is clicked

Lottanzb is setup for frontend_mode = True and is set to monitor a local hellanzb instance that was already setup.

Per the source code, it looks like the hellanzb prefs are not loaded/imported if lottanzb is in frontend mode (lines 56-57 in lottanzb.py)

Revision history for this message
Severin H (severinh) wrote :

Hi mrhappi,

the HellaNZB preferences aren't loaded in front-end mode because it's not easy for LottaNZB to automatically determine where they are in every case. In the next version of LottaNZB, you will be able to specify the location of the configuration file. LottaNZB won't change the configuration file in any way in this mode. It will be parsed, so that LottaNZB knows where the download directory is etc.

In LottaNZB 0.2 we simply forgot to hide the download directory button. Thanks for reporting this bug and stay tuned! LottaNZB 0.2.1 or 0.3 (?) is going to be released in the weeks to come.

Changed in lottanzb:
assignee: nobody → lantash
importance: Undecided → High
milestone: none → 0.2.1
status: New → In Progress
Revision history for this message
Andrew Williams (nikdoof) wrote :

Already commited into trunk in r257

Changed in lottanzb:
status: In Progress → Fix Committed
Revision history for this message
Andrew Williams (nikdoof) wrote :

Apologies, the button is hidden in trunk r257, Severin is talking about a more perm fix.

Changed in lottanzb:
status: Fix Committed → In Progress
Severin H (severinh)
Changed in lottanzb:
milestone: 0.2.1 → 0.3
Severin H (severinh)
Changed in lottanzb:
status: In Progress → Fix Committed
Severin H (severinh)
Changed in lottanzb: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.